Abstract

The invention relates to the technical field of water construction structures, in particular to a water self-floating environment-friendly slurry pool. Comprises a tank body unit for storing mud and a bracket fixed with the tank body unit; the support is provided with an air bag for providing buoyancy for the pool body unit to enable the pool body unit to float on the water surface and a limiting structure for limiting the movement of the support to prevent the support from being separated from the design position. The mud pit disclosed by the invention is simple in structure, suitable for pile foundation construction water areas with higher water cleanliness, capable of avoiding pollution to water, low in manufacturing cost, convenient to operate and high in popularization value.

Background
The Huizhou Luzhou to Taimei bridge and its approach project have the starting point located in the middle of the goose pond at the junction of the Luzhou town and the horizontal asphalt, crossing the east river channel, and ending at the junction of the Taimeizhen national road G205 and the government road in the Boluo county through the disc top and the asphalt isolation. The total length of the route is 7.61km (wherein, a super bridge 1516.4m/1 seat, an in-line middle bridge 111.2m/2 seat and an out-of-line middle bridge 41.96m/1 seat are arranged, the culvert 25 road and other road sections are roadbed), and the two-way four-road primary highway standard is adopted, the pavement width is 21.5m and the bridge width is 23.0m.
The Dongjiang extra large bridge is a prestressed concrete girder bridge, the main bridge adopts a (85+150+85) m prestressed concrete continuous rigid frame, the approach bridge spans the dykes on two sides and adopts 2-to-6-span (the spans are 25.0+40.0+25.0 and 40.0+40.0+30.0) prestressed concrete continuous box girders, the rest positions adopt assembled prestressed concrete small box girders (33 spans) with the spans of 30m, the lower structure of the main bridge adopts plate piers, the lower structure of the approach bridge adopts column piers, and the foundation is a bored cast-in-place pile. The 7# pier to 12# pier and the 22# pier to 28# pier are positioned at river branches or river channels, belong to water construction, and the rest pier positions are positioned in a water-free area in a dead water period, and belong to land construction. The main channel of the east river is a limited V-level channel, the long-term planning is a inland III-level channel, the highest navigation water level is designed to be 24.94m, the lowest navigation water level is designed to be 14.80m, and the river channel water level amplitude is large under the influence of flood season. Because the drilling area is a water conservation area, the requirements on construction environment protection are high, muddy water generated by drilling needs to be effectively controlled, river water cannot be polluted, and therefore a new technology needs to be developed to cope with the muddy water generated in the drilling process.
Disclosure of Invention
The invention aims to solve the defects of the background technology and provides a water self-floating environment-friendly mud pit.
The technical scheme of the invention is as follows: the utility model provides a self-floating environmental protection mud pond on water which characterized in that: comprises a tank body unit for storing mud and a bracket fixed with the tank body unit; the support is provided with an air bag for providing buoyancy for the pool body unit to enable the pool body unit to float on the water surface and a limiting structure for limiting the movement of the support to prevent the support from being separated from the design position.
Further the bracket comprises a plurality of fixing units which are axially arranged along the cell body unit; the fixing unit comprises an inner side vertical rod fixed on the outer side of the tank body unit, an upper cross rod and a lower cross rod which are fixed on the inner side vertical rod and are horizontally and transversely arranged, and an outer side vertical rod fixed on one end, far away from the tank body unit, of the upper cross rod and the lower cross rod; the inner side vertical rod, the outer side vertical rod, the upper cross rod and the lower cross rod form a frame structure for limiting and fixing the air bag.
The limiting structure further comprises a plurality of pile foundations inserted and beaten at intervals on the outer side of the tank body unit, and the pile foundations encircle the outer side of the tank body unit; the pool body unit is connected with the pile foundation through a chain.
Further the upper cross rod and the lower cross rod are respectively arranged above and below the water surface, and one ends of the upper cross rod and the lower cross rod, which are far away from the tank body unit, are respectively connected with the pile foundation through chains.
A connecting ring is arranged at one end of the chain, which is far away from the tank body unit; the connecting ring is sleeved on the pile foundation.
A walking platform is further paved on the upper cross rod; and a guardrail is arranged on one side of the walking platform, which is far away from the pool body unit.
Further the cell body unit comprises a side wall plate arranged vertically and a bottom plate fixed at the bottom of the side wall plate; the side wall plate is of an annular structure and is fixed on the bottom plate to form a pool body structure with an opening at the upper end with the bottom plate.
A vertical partition plate is arranged on the inner side of the side wall plate to divide the tank body into a pulp storage tank and a sedimentation tank; the upper end of the partition plate is provided with a notch communicated with the slurry storage tank and the sedimentation tank.
And a diagonal bracing is further arranged between the inner side cross bar and the lower cross bar.
A control tube for controlling the inflation and deflation of the air bag is further arranged on the air bag; and a control valve is arranged on the control pipe.
The invention has the advantages that: 1. the air bag structure is arranged outside the tank body unit, so that the slurry tank is suspended at a construction position and is used for receiving slurry generated during drilling and piling, the pollution to the water body caused by directly discharging the slurry into the water body can be effectively avoided, and the whole slurry tank is simple in structure and convenient to operate;
2. the air bag is limited and fixed through the frame structure formed by welding and connecting the plurality of rods to form the fixing unit, so that the structure is simple, the installation and the operation are convenient, and the cost is low;
3. the pool body unit is limited by inserting the pile foundation, so that the pool body unit is prevented from drifting away, the pool body unit is limited to a construction position, and the storage of slurry is facilitated;
4. the two-chain structure is used for fixing the bracket, so that the stability of the cell body unit can be improved, the cell body unit can move in a small range, but the cell body unit cannot be completely separated from a pile foundation, and the damage caused by the pile foundation in the use process is avoided;
5. by arranging the walking platform and the guardrails, the construction treatment of personnel is facilitated, and the convenience degree of construction is improved;
6. the annular side wall plate and the annular bottom plate are combined into the pool body unit, so that the structure is simple, the installation and the manufacture are convenient, and the transportation and the construction are convenient;
7. the tank body unit is divided into two tank body structures through the partition plate, one tank body is used for storing, and the other tank body is used for precipitating, so that the slurry can be subjected to precipitation treatment, and the volume of the slurry is reduced.
The mud pit disclosed by the invention is simple in structure, suitable for pile foundation construction water areas with higher water cleanliness, capable of avoiding pollution to water, low in manufacturing cost, convenient to operate and high in popularization value.

Detailed Description
The invention will now be described in further detail with reference to the drawings and to specific examples.
As shown in fig. 1-2, a water self-floating environmental protection mud pit is provided, the pit body unit of the embodiment comprises side wall plates 4 arranged vertically and a bottom plate 5 fixed at the bottom of the side wall plates 4, the side wall plates 4 are of annular structures, and the side wall plates 4 are fixed on the bottom plate 5 to form a pit body structure with an upper end opening with the bottom plate 5. The inner side of the side wall plate 4 is provided with a vertical partition plate 16 for dividing the tank body into a pulp storage tank 18 and a sedimentation tank 19, and the upper end of the partition plate 16 is provided with a notch 17 for communicating the pulp storage tank 18 and the sedimentation tank 19. Even in the use, mud that pile foundation construction produced can be discharged to the storage in the pond 18, then collect the back of accomplishing, can shift mud to the sedimentation tank 19 in from the storage in the pond 18 through the notch 17, after simple sedimentation treatment, can discharge the processing to the supernatant in the sedimentation tank 19, this part clear solution can not cause the pollution to the water, and remaining mud part can carry out subsequent handling through transporting, can not discharge in the water.
The pile foundation construction area is located in the water, in order to make the cell body unit float on the water surface, this embodiment is provided with the support in the cell body unit outside, install the gasbag 11 of floating usefulness on the support, as shown in fig. 1 and 2, the support includes a plurality of fixed units of arranging along cell body unit axial, fixed unit is including fixing the inboard montant 6 in the cell body unit outside, fix on inboard montant 6 along horizontal transverse arrangement's last horizontal pole 8 and bottom rail 9, and fix the outside montant 7 of cell body unit one end is kept away from to last horizontal pole 8 and bottom rail 9, inboard montant 6, outside montant 7, go up horizontal pole 8 and bottom rail 9 form the frame construction who restricts fixed gasbag 11. The air bag 11 is provided with a control tube 12 for controlling the inflation and deflation of the air bag 11, and the control tube 12 is provided with a control valve 13. By inflating and deflating the air bag 11, the floating height of the cell body unit can be controlled, and the floating height can be adjusted according to the mud beam stored in the cell body unit.
In order to avoid the floating of the tank body unit, the limiting structure is arranged around the tank body unit in the embodiment. As shown in fig. 1 and 2, the limiting structure comprises a plurality of pile foundations 1 inserted and beaten at intervals on the outer side of the tank body unit, the pile foundations 1 encircle the outer side of the tank body unit, the limiting structure comprises four pile foundations 1 which are respectively arranged on two sides of the tank body unit, two pile foundations 1 are arranged on each side, and the tank body unit is connected with the pile foundations 1 through a chain 2.
The concrete linking mode of this embodiment is shown in fig. 1, in which the upper cross bar 8 and the lower cross bar 9 are disposed above and below the water surface, and one ends of the upper cross bar 8 and the lower cross bar 9, which are far away from the pool unit, are connected with the pile foundation 1 through the chain 2, respectively. One end of the chain is fixed at one end of the upper cross rod 8 and the lower cross rod 9, which is far away from the cell body unit, the other end of the chain is provided with a connecting ring 3, and the connecting ring 3 is sleeved on the pile foundation 1. Namely, the whole pool body unit can rise or fall along with the water surface, and the connecting ring 3 rises and falls on the pile foundation 1 along with the pool body unit.
As shown in fig. 1, a walking platform 14 is laid on the upper cross bar 8, and a guardrail 15 is arranged on one side of the walking platform 14 away from the pool body unit. A diagonal brace 10 is arranged between the inner cross bar 6 and the lower cross bar 9.
When the device is used, the pool body unit is dragged to a drilling construction position through the tug, then the pool body unit is fixed on the pile foundation 1 which is already inserted and beaten through the chain 2, then slurry generated by drilling is discharged into the pool body unit, the floating height of the whole slurry pool is controlled through controlling the inflation amount of the air bags 11 until all drilling construction is completed, the slurry is subjected to simple sedimentation treatment, supernatant liquid is discharged, then the rest sedimentation part is subjected to subsequent treatment, and the tug drags the slurry pool to the next construction position after completion.
